The bidding for British Steel has come to an end

A bid thought to be worth between £60 and £70 million has been accepted for British Steel. The Turkish company, Ataer Holding, has emerged as the soon to be owner of British Steel. Ataer Holding is the largest stakeholder in a Turkish steel group, Edermir with 49.3% of shares. Edermir is Turkey’s largest steel producer.

The Official Receiver is meeting with Ataer Holding to discuss their new ownership and to see what their intentions are with Scunthorpe’s steelwork company.

The Official Receiver said:

“Following discussions with a number of potential purchasers for the British Steel group over the past few weeks I am pleased to say I have now received an acceptable offer from Ataer Holdings A.S. for the purchase of the whole business and I am now focusing on finalising the sale. I will be looking to conclude this process in the coming weeks, during which time British Steel continues to trade and supply its customers as normal. I would like to thank all employees, suppliers and customers for their continued support which has been essential to get to this point.”
